Nurse Training Coordinator
At Western Home Communities, our Nurse Training Coordinator plays a critical role in shaping the future of our nursing teams. This position is responsible for welcoming, training, and developing new and transitioning nursing staff to ensure they feel confident, supported, and fully prepared to provide exceptional resident care.
You’ll be the bridge between education and practice—bringing clinical expertise, strong communication, and a passion for teaching into every orientation, training session, and hands-on coaching moment. From guiding new hires through onboarding to providing one-on-one support and re-training when needed, you’ll directly influence staff success, retention, and resident outcomes.

What You Will Do in This Role
Provide onboarding, orientation, and ongoing training for new and transitioning nursing staff
Deliver hands-on clinical education and 1:1 coaching to support skill development and confidence
Ensure staff are trained on proper nursing care, documentation, and facility policies
Coordinate and schedule orientation activities in collaboration with leadership and staffing teams
Support clinical onboarding and assist in evaluating staff readiness and competency
Train staff on infection control, safety practices, and proper use of lift equipment and procedures
Ensure accurate documentation practices and train staff on electronic charting systems (PCC)
Conduct audits and support compliance with state, federal, and organizational standards
Collaborates with Director of Education, education team members and department leaders on staff performance and training needs
Maintain orientation records, training documentation, and compliance tracking in Workday or other systems
What We’re Looking For (Requirements)
Active LPN or RN license in Iowa
Minimum of 2 years of long-term care experience required
Passion for teaching, mentoring, and staff development
Strong communication and leadership skills
Ability to work independently and manage multiple training schedules
CPR certification (BLS) required
Valid driver’s license and reliable transportation (travel between sites required)
Ability to flex schedule, including evenings/weekends as needed for training support
Comfortable working in a fast-paced clinical environment with changing priorities
Strong critical thinking, judgment, and problem-solving skills

Western Home Communities is a continuing care retirement community (CCRC). That means we offer residential living for seniors at every stage of health, activity and independence, from those who need no assistance, to others who require round-the-clock nursing care. This is often referred to as the continuum of care.
